Prep and Cook Time
- Readiness: 15 minutes
- Slow Cooker Cooking Time: 8 hours on low or 4-5 hours on high
- Total Time: Approximately 8-8.5 hours
Yield
Serves 6 hearty sandwiches
Difficulty Level
Easy – minimal hands-on time, perfect for busy days or beginners eager to impress
Ingredients
- 3 to 4 pounds beef chuck roast, trimmed of excess fat
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- 1 cup beef broth, low sodium
- 1 large onion, thinly sliced
- 4 cloves garlic, minced
- 2 teaspoons dried Italian seasoning blend (see below)
- 1 teaspoon dried oregano
- 1 teaspoon fennel seeds, crushed
- 1/2 teaspoon crushed red pepper flakes (optional for heat)
- 1/2 cup dry white wine (or extra broth)
- Salt and freshly ground black pepper, to taste
- 6 Italian rolls, toasted
- Provolone cheese slices, for topping
- Fresh parsley, chopped for garnish

Choosing the Perfect Cut of Beef for Tender Flavor
For Savory Slow Cooker Italian Beef Sandwiches You’ll Love, selecting beef chuck roast ensures richness and fork-tender texture after hours of slow cooking. This well-marbled cut breaks down beautifully, absorbing the seasoning blend and releasing natural juices to keep every sandwich moist. Avoid lean cuts like sirloin, which can dry out, and opt instead for shoulders or briskets if chuck is unavailable for similar results.
step by Step Slow Cooker Preparation Tips
- Sear the beef: He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Sear the chuck roast on all sides until golden brown, about 3-4 minutes per side. this caramelization builds rich flavor and seals in juices.
- Layer the aromatics: place sliced onions and minced garlic at the bottom of your slow cooker. These will infuse the beef with depth and sweetness.
- Season generously: Sprinkle Italian seasoning blend, oregano, crushed fennel seeds, red pepper flakes, salt, and black pepper evenly over the beef before placing it on top of the onions.
- Add liquids: Pour beef broth and white wine around the meat to keep it moist and enhance the sauce.
- Cook low and slow: Cover and cook on low for 8 hours, or on high for 4-5 hours. The beef should be tender enough to shred easily with two forks.
- Shred and soak: Remove beef and shred it directly in the slow cooker juices to soak up every drop of seasoning.
- Assemble sandwiches: Pile shredded beef on toasted Italian rolls, add provolone cheese slices, and briefly broil or cover to melt.
- Garnish and serve: Finish with a sprinkle of fresh parsley and extra sauce for dipping.

Chef’s Notes & Tips for Success
- Make it ahead: Slow cooker beef sandwiches taste even better the next day; store beef with juices in the fridge and gently reheat before serving.
- Substitutions: If fennel seeds aren’t on hand, add a pinch of anise or an extra dash of oregano for a similar aromatic effect.
- Low-sodium options: Use reduced-sodium beef broth and adjust seasoning at the end to avoid oversalting.
- For thicker sauce: Remove beef and simmer the juices on stovetop to reduce, or stir in a cornstarch slurry (1 tsp cornstarch + 1 tbsp water) until thickened.
- Vegetarian alternative: Substitute meat with seitan or portobello mushrooms and slow cook with the same seasoning blend for hearty flavor.

Q: What makes Italian beef sandwiches so special?
A: Italian beef sandwiches are beloved for their tender, flavorful roast beef soaked in a rich, seasoned au jus. The combination of savory meat, the peppery jus, and soft Italian rolls creates a mouthwatering balance that’s hard to resist.
Q: Why use a slow cooker for making Italian beef?
A: The slow cooker allows the beef to cook low and slow, breaking down the meat’s fibers until it’s incredibly tender and juicy. this method also lets the flavors meld beautifully, resulting in a rich, deeply seasoned au jus that soaks right into the sandwich.
Q: What cut of beef is best for Italian beef sandwiches?
A: Chuck roast is the go-to choice. It’s affordable, flavorful, and becomes incredibly tender when slow-cooked. Its marbling helps keep the meat juicy throughout the long cooking process.
Q: Can I customize the seasoning to suit my taste?
A: Absolutely! While traditional recipes use garlic, oregano, and Italian seasoning, you can adjust the spice level with crushed red pepper flakes or add herbs like rosemary or thyme to create your own signature twist.
Q: What type of bread works best for these sandwiches?
A: Soft, sturdy Italian rolls or French baguettes are perfect. They hold up to the juicy beef and au jus without falling apart, making every bite satisfyingly messy and delicious.
Q: Are there any popular toppings to add?
A: Definitely! Sautéed giardiniera (Italian pickled vegetables) adds a tangy crunch, while provolone or mozzarella cheese melts perfectly atop the beef for extra richness. Some folks also enjoy roasted peppers or caramelized onions.
Q: How long should I cook the beef in the slow cooker?
A: Typically, 8 hours on low or 5-6 hours on high yields tender, shreddable beef. However, cooking times can vary based on your slow cooker model and the size of your roast.
Q: Can I prepare this recipe ahead of time?
A: Yes! Slow cooker Italian beef sandwiches are ideal for make-ahead meals.You can cook the beef the day before, refrigerate it, and reheat gently before serving. The flavors frequently enough improve after a day of resting.
